ANNIVERSARY SERIES – “SILVER SNOOPY AWARD” 50TH ANNIVERSARY
Snoopy has been NASA’s safety watchdog since the 1960s. In particular, their “Silver Snoopy Award” has become the ultimate thank you for mission success. This prestigious prize was presented to OMEGA in 1970 for the watchmaker’s role in space exploration – including its critical contribution to the safe return of Apollo 13.

To celebrate the 50th anniversary of that achievement, OMEGA released the Speedmaster “Silver Snoopy Award” 50th Anniversary watch. The stainless steel case of this 42 mm chronograph is presented on a blue nylon fabric strap, which features the trajectory of the Apollo 13 mission on the embossed lining. The silver dial has blue PVD angle‑shaped hour markers and hands, as well as an embossed silver Snoopy medallion on the blue subdial at 9 o’clock.

On the caseback of this luxury Swiss watch, Snoopy has gone into orbit, thanks to his animated black and white Command and Service Module (CSM) on a magical hand. When the chronograph seconds hand is used, Snoopy takes a trip around the mysterious far side of the moon, which has been decorated on the scratch‑resistant sapphire crystal using a micro‑structured metallisation. In the distance, an Earth disc rotates once per minute, in sync with the watch’s small seconds hand.

There is also a blue ceramic bezel ring with a white enamel tachymeter scale. The non‑limited watch is driven by the OMEGA Co‑Axial Master Chronometer Calibre 3861 for ultimate precision and magnetic‑resistance.
